Handing off the Vantlog audit-log viewer ahead of Thursday's cut. Pagination fix is merged; the export bug from last sprint is closed. Retention filter still reads from the old index — known, tracked, not a blocker. Staging matches production except for the shortened retention window. Nothing else in flight; Priya from platform reviewed the access checks Monday. For the release build, the viewer needs its runtime settings injected at deploy, and the current values are these.

deployment values, kahof-yadug:
[gorys]
team = silael
access_code = ac_00d620
owner = istox.oliys
host = gorys.torvastack.example
port = 9000
peer = holmir.merlaqsoft.example
salt = 9fdae78a
pin = 2358

Before promoting the Fernwheel dashboard to production, run the contrast sweep against every themed surface, including the high-density table view and the dark-mode toast notifications. Any pair falling below the 4.5:1 threshold for body text, or 3:1 for large headings, blocks the release — no exceptions without sign-off from the accessibility guild. Record failing selectors in the audit log, attach screenshots at both zoom levels, and confirm the sweep ran against the exact artifact identified by the token below.

build token for kagaf-hahof: htk14_9d3d4d26d7d8de

On the migration in this PR: for zero-downtime changes on Tallowmere we always do expand/contract — add the new column, dual-write, backfill in batches, then drop the old one in a later release. Never rename in place; old pods will still read the old shape during rollout. Batch sizing matters because backfills share the primary. The limits we enforce for backfill jobs are these.

constants for bawif-kawif:
QUOTAS = {
    "ulaael": 5,
    "holael": 10,
}

- [ ] Step 7: Archive cold storage buckets (Glacierline tier). Confirm both ceremony witnesses are present, verify bucket manifests match the Oxbow ledger, then seal the archive key shares. Plugin authors may observe but not handle shares. Once sealed, the archive index itself is encrypted and can only be reopened with the passphrase below.

vault phrase of badup-hahig = tamael-aldael-kelmir-istael-fenok-istwyn-tamius-jorath-oliion